Transaction 05995465e39ee41b6e8f0d52a61b9f8e3a05c24f084986d3ececd6dd5e44a5b9
1 Input
1 Output
-
05995465e39ee41b6e8f0d52a61b9f8e3a05c24f084986d3ececd6dd5e44a5b9:0
- value
- 13032654
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d6585c106b4245df37aa4073b51a0bb11b14860
- address
- bc1q84jctsgxksj9mum65srnk5dqhvgmzjrq083hy4